By Kishla Askins 1 hr ago

After more than 30 years in uniform, on the frontlines of healthcare, national defense, and federal policymaking, I’ve seen how national security is often defined too narrowly.

We tend to think of it as something that happens “over there,” in far-off battlefields or classified briefings in Washington. But the truth is, security starts here at home.

Too often, the Midwest is treated as an afterthought in that conversation, and that’s a risk we can’t afford. If we’re serious about protecting this country, then we can’t overlook the places that grow our food, move our freight, train our troops, and build our future.

Places like Omaha.

Both Cook Political Report and Larry Sabato’s Crystal Ball, two of the leading election forecast publications, have upgraded their ratings for Nebraska’s 2nd District from toss-up to leans Democratic. Making it a likely candidate for big spending as the GOP attempts to maintain or bolster its small majority, and Democrats try to take back control.
